/* Challenge 003 Challenge #1 Create a script to generate 5-smooth numbers, whose prime divisors are less or equal to 5. They are also called Hamming/Regular/Ugly numbers. For more information, please check this wikipedia. */ #include #include #include #include int min3(int a, int b, int c) { return std::min(a, std::min(b, c)); } // hamming number generator std::deque q2, q3, q5; int next_hamming() { // init three queues with 1 if (q2.empty()) { q2.push_back(1); q3.push_back(1); q5.push_back(1); } // get the smallest of the queue heads int n = min3(q2.front(), q3.front(), q5.front()); // shift used multiples if (n == q2.front()) q2.pop_front(); if (n == q3.front()) q3.pop_front(); if (n == q5.front()) q5.pop_front(); // push next multiples q2.push_back(2*n); q3.push_back(3*n); q5.push_back(5*n); return n; } int main(int argc, char* argv[]) { if (argc == 2) { for (int i = 0; i < atoi(argv[1]); i++) std::cout << next_hamming() << std::endl; } }
